Bring your dog along for a B.A.R.K. Ranger hike through the beautiful Miller Woods on Saturday, June 29, from 9:00 am to 10:30 am. Meet at the front door of the Paul H. Douglas Center. The hike’s distance can vary based on the interest of the participants. Don’t forget your leash, pick up bags and water. This spectacular hike winds through diverse habitats such as the globally rare black oak savanna, wetlands, and dunes.
The Paul H. Douglas Center for Environmental Education is located in the western portion of the national lakeshore at 100 North Lake Street, about one mile north of U.S. Highway 12.
